az dms project
Hinweis
Diese Befehlsgruppe verfügt über Befehle, die sowohl in Azure CLI als auch in mindestens einer Erweiterung definiert sind. Installieren Sie jede Erweiterung, um von ihren erweiterten Funktionen zu profitieren. Weitere Informationen zu Erweiterungen
Verwalten von Projekten für eine Instanz des Azure-Datenbankmigrationsdiensts (klassisch).
Befehle
Name | Beschreibung | Typ | Status |
---|---|---|---|
az dms project check-name |
Überprüfen Sie, ob ein bestimmter Projektname in einer bestimmten Instanz von DMS sowie in der Gültigkeit des Namens verfügbar ist. |
Core | Allgemein verfügbar |
az dms project create |
Erstellen Sie ein Migrationsprojekt, das mehrere Vorgänge enthalten kann. |
Core | Allgemein verfügbar |
az dms project create (dms-preview Erweiterung) |
Erstellen Sie ein Migrationsprojekt, das mehrere Vorgänge enthalten kann. |
Erweiterung | Allgemein verfügbar |
az dms project delete |
Löschen eines Projekts. |
Core | Allgemein verfügbar |
az dms project list |
Listet die Projekte in einer Instanz von DMS auf. |
Core | Allgemein verfügbar |
az dms project show |
Zeigen Sie die Details eines Migrationsprojekts an. |
Core | Allgemein verfügbar |
az dms project task |
Verwalten von Aufgaben für das Projekt einer Azure-Datenbankmigrationsdienstinstanz (klassisches) Projekt. |
Kern und Erweiterung | Allgemein verfügbar |
az dms project task cancel |
Abbrechen einer Aufgabe, wenn sie derzeit in die Warteschlange gestellt oder ausgeführt wird. |
Core | Allgemein verfügbar |
az dms project task cancel (dms-preview Erweiterung) |
Dieser Befehl ist veraltet. Verwenden Sie stattdessen den Stoppbefehl. |
Erweiterung | Allgemein verfügbar |
az dms project task check-name |
Überprüfen Sie, ob ein bestimmter Vorgangsname in einer bestimmten Instanz von DMS sowie der Gültigkeit des Namens verfügbar ist. |
Core | Allgemein verfügbar |
az dms project task create |
Erstellen und starten Sie eine Migrationsaufgabe. |
Core | Allgemein verfügbar |
az dms project task create (dms-preview Erweiterung) |
Erstellen und starten Sie eine Migrationsaufgabe. |
Erweiterung | Allgemein verfügbar |
az dms project task cutover |
Führen Sie für eine Onlinemigrationsaufgabe die Migration durch Ausführen eines Übernahmevorgangs aus. |
Core | Allgemein verfügbar |
az dms project task delete |
Löschen sie eine Migrationsaufgabe. |
Core | Allgemein verfügbar |
az dms project task list |
Listen Sie die Vorgänge in einem Projekt auf. Einige Aufgaben haben möglicherweise den Status "Unbekannt", was angibt, dass beim Abfragen des Status dieser Aufgabe ein Fehler aufgetreten ist. |
Core | Allgemein verfügbar |
az dms project task restart |
Starten Sie entweder die gesamte Migration oder nur ein angegebenes Objekt neu. Derzeit nur von MongoDB-Migrationen unterstützt. |
Erweiterung | Allgemein verfügbar |
az dms project task show |
Zeigen Sie die Details einer Migrationsaufgabe an. Verwenden Sie "--expand", um weitere Details zu erhalten. |
Core | Allgemein verfügbar |
az dms project task stop |
Beendet die Aufgabe oder beendet die Migration des angegebenen Objekts (nur MongoDB-Migrationen). |
Erweiterung | Allgemein verfügbar |
az dms project check-name
Überprüfen Sie, ob ein bestimmter Projektname in einer bestimmten Instanz von DMS sowie in der Gültigkeit des Namens verfügbar ist.
az dms project check-name --name
--resource-group
--service-name
Erforderliche Parameter
Der zu überprüfende Projektname.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name>
konfigurieren.
Der Name des Diensts.
Globale Parameter
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ID
kon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
az dms project create
Erstellen Sie ein Migrationsprojekt, das mehrere Vorgänge enthalten kann.
Die folgenden Projektkonfigurationen werden unterstützt: -) Quelle -> Ziel
- SQL –> SQLDB
- PostgreSQL -> AzureDbForPostgreSQL
- MySQL -> AzureDbForMySQL.
az dms project create --location
--name
--resource-group
--service-name
--source-platform
--target-platform
[--tags]
Beispiele
Erstellen Sie ein SQL to SQLDB-Projekt für eine DMS-Instanz.
az dms project create -l westus -n sqlproject -g myresourcegroup --service-name mydms --source-platform SQL --target-platform SQLDB --tags tagName1=tagValue1 tagWithNoValue
Erstellen Sie ein PostgreSql zu AzureDbForPostgreSql-Projekt für eine DMS-Instanz.
az dms project create -l westus -n pgproject -g myresourcegroup --service-name mydms --source-platform PostgreSQL --target-platform AzureDbForPostgreSQL --tags tagName1=tagValue1 tagWithNoValue
Erstellen Sie ein MySQL-zu AzureDbForMySQL-Projekt für eine DMS-Instanz.
az dms project create -l westus -n mysqlproject -g myresourcegroup --service-name mydms --source-platform MySQL --target-platform AzureDbForMySQL --tags tagName1=tagValue1 tagWithNoValue
Erforderliche Parameter
Standort. Werte aus: az account list-locations
. Sie können den standardmäßig verwendeten Standort mit az configure --defaults location=<location>
konfigurieren.
Der Name des Projekts.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name>
konfigurieren.
Der Name des Diensts.
Der Servertyp für die Quelldatenbank. Die unterstützten Typen sind: SQL, PostgreSQL, MySQL.
Der Diensttyp für die Zieldatenbank. Die unterstützten Typen sind: SQLDB, AzureDbForPostgreSQL, AzureDbForMySQL.
Optionale Parameter
Eine durch Leerzeichen getrennte Liste von Tags im Format "tag1[=value1]".
Globale Parameter
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ID
kon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
az dms project create (dms-preview Erweiterung)
Erstellen Sie ein Migrationsprojekt, das mehrere Vorgänge enthalten kann.
Die folgenden Projektkonfigurationen werden unterstützt: -) source -> target 1) SQL - SQL -> SQLDB 2) PostgreSQL -> AzureDbForPostgreSQL 3) MongoDB -> MongoDB (für die Migration zu Cosmos DB über ihre MongoDB-API).
az dms project create --location
--name
--resource-group
--service-name
--source-platform
--target-platform
[--tags]
Beispiele
Erstellen Sie ein SQL to SQLDB-Projekt für eine DMS-Instanz.
az dms project create -l westus -n sqlproject -g myresourcegroup --service-name mydms --source-platform SQL --target-platform SQLDB --tags tagName1=tagValue1 tagWithNoValue
Erstellen Sie ein PostgreSql zu AzureDbForPostgreSql-Projekt für eine DMS-Instanz.
az dms project create -l westus -n pgproject -g myresourcegroup --service-name mydms --source-platform PostgreSQL --target-platform AzureDbForPostgreSQL --tags tagName1=tagValue1 tagWithNoValue
Erforderliche Parameter
Standort. Werte aus: az account list-locations
. Sie können den standardmäßig verwendeten Standort mit az configure --defaults location=<location>
konfigurieren.
Der Name des Projekts. DMS Project ist eine logische Gruppierung, die Quelldatenbankverbindung, Zieldatenbankverbindung und eine Liste der zu migrierenden Datenbanken umfasst.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name>
konfigurieren.
Der Name des Diensts. DMS Service ist eine Azure-Instanz, die Datenbankmigrationen durchführt.
Der Servertyp für die Quelldatenbank. Die unterstützten Typen sind: SQL, PostgreSQL, MongoDB.
Der Diensttyp für die Zieldatenbank. Die unterstützten Typen sind: SQLDB, AzureDbForPostgreSQL, MongoDB.
Optionale Parameter
Eine durch Leerzeichen getrennte Liste von Tags im Tag1[=Wert1]"-Format.
Globale Parameter
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ID
kon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
az dms project delete
Löschen eines Projekts.
az dms project delete --name
--resource-group
--service-name
[--delete-running-tasks]
[--yes]
Beispiele
Löschen eines Projekts. (automatisch generiert)
az dms project delete --name MyProject --resource-group MyResourceGroup --service-name MyService
Erforderliche Parameter
Der Name des Projekts.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name>
konfigurieren.
Der Name des Diensts.
Optionale Parameter
Brechen Sie alle ausgeführten Vorgänge ab, bevor Sie das Projekt löschen.
Nicht zur Bestätigung auffordern
Globale Parameter
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ID
kon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
az dms project list
Listet die Projekte in einer Instanz von DMS auf.
az dms project list --resource-group
--service-name
Beispiele
Listet die Projekte in einer Instanz von DMS auf. (automatisch generiert)
az dms project list --resource-group MyResourceGroup --service-name MyService
Erforderliche Parameter
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name>
konfigurieren.
Der Name des Diensts.
Globale Parameter
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ID
kon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.
az dms project show
Zeigen Sie die Details eines Migrationsprojekts an.
az dms project show --name
--resource-group
--service-name
Beispiele
Zeigen Sie die Details eines Migrationsprojekts an. (automatisch generiert)
az dms project show --name MyProject --resource-group MyResourceGroup --service-name MyService
Erforderliche Parameter
Der Name des Projekts.
Name der Ressourcengruppe Sie können die Standardgruppe mit az configure --defaults group=<name>
konfigurieren.
Der Name des Diensts.
Globale Parameter
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.
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.
Nur Fehler anzeigen und Warnungen unterdrücken.
Ausgabeformat.
J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.
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ID
konfigurieren.
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.